dilluns, 15 de maig de 2017

VPN HOST TO HOST HOW TO USING OPENVPN (terminal)

VPN HOST TO HOST HOW TO USING OPENVPN (terminal)

Explicaré pas per pas com es configura una VPN en Ubuntu 10.04, entenc que a Debian funcionarà igual.

Pas 1) Instalar openvpn:

sudo apt-get install openvpn

Pas 2) Generar la Clau que haurà de disposar tant el servidor com el client que vulgui connectar-se a la VPN.

Nota: El client haurà d'haver aconseguit la clau de forma segura abans de poder connectar-se.

sudo openvpn --genkey --secret clau.key

Creem el fitxer de configuració en el servidor:

sudo nano /etc/openvpn/server.conf

# dispositivo de tunel
dev tun

# se define como:
# ifconfig ipdelserver ipdelcliente
# sugiero no cambiarle

ifconfig 10.8.0.1 10.8.0.2

 # Clave del servidor
secret /etc/openvpn/clau.key
#puerto
port 1194
#usuario bajo el cual ejecutaremos
#user nobody
#group nobody
# opciones, comprimir con lzo, ping cada 15 segs, verbose 1 (bajo)
comp-lzo
ping 15
verb 4
Pas 3) Engeguem el servidor fent:

 sudo openvpn -server.conf
Anem al Client:
Pas 2) sudo apt-get install openvpn